Action: Gas operated, rotating bolt
Overall length: 730 mm (with "medium" barrel)
Barrel length: n/a
Weight: 3.7 kg with empty magazine
Rate of fire: 800-850 rounds per minute
Magazine capacity: 30 rounds
Khaybar KH 2002 assault rifle is a recent development of the Iranian Defense Industry Organization; this rifle was first shown in 2004 and is intended to replace the obsolete 7.62x51 HKG3 rifles of German origin, which are license-built in Iran since the Shah times. Khaybar KH 2002 assault rifle can be best described as a bullpup conversion of the Iranian S-5.56 rifle, which is a direct copy of the Chinese CQ assault rifle.
Khaybar KH 2002 assault rifle is gas operated, selectively fired rifle of bullpup layout. It uses M16-type direct gas system with multi-lugrotary bolt locking. Polymer pistol grip with enlarged trigger guard is attached below the tubular barrel shroud. Safety / fire selector lever is located at the left side of the receiver, behind magazine housing and away from the pistol grip. Ejection is to the right side only.
